Labourer stabbed to death in Sembulan
Published on: Wednesday, February 21, 2018
Kota Kinabalu: A 56-year-old man was found dead after he was believed to have been stabbed by a distant relative in Kg Sembulan Lama at around 6.30pm, Tuesday. The labourer was found with stab wounds all over his body. A suspect was caught. The victim's wife, Salina Abdul, 58, said the victim went out of the house to check on his boat but moments later, her family told her that he had been stabbed by the suspect, who was in his thirties.

She said the suspect had taken a liking to one of their children but they did not agree to it, causing an altercation between them."We did not agree to the relationship as the suspect had mental issues.
